A Holistic Approach to Time Management

When most of us think of time management, we think of time blocking, or setting a schedule that we hope will be better than the last one.


However, just like change management is really about transition management, a holistic approach to time management is needed to create something that actually helps you feel more in control over your life, health, relationships and work. 


Our schedule is where we live… where and how we spend time, with who, when and why.

Which necessitates  taking  a few steps back to assess some important aspects of our lives before we just start employing time management techniques.  We have to learn and understand more about our self, values, priorities,  energy levels and more.


I recommend to clients that they do a health& wellbeing energy assessment first.  This assessment also asks us to identify our values as well.  Once we gain insight on how to understand ourselves better and manage ourselves more effectively, that translates into creating a plan that is far beyond common time management tools and techniques.


Below is a portion of the assessment.  Take the assessment when you are in a quiet non distracted place.


Let it guide you as you begin to look at managing time and energy in a whole new way.


SELF LEADERSHIP - PERSONAL HEALTH AND WELLBEING ASSESSMENT


Please consider the following areas of your health and wellbeing and rate level of satisfaction in each area, from 1-10. 1 indicates not satisfied at all, while 5 is “moderately/ average” and 10 is the most satisfied.


Then consider your desired level of satisfaction in each of these categories, then note the point differential. 


1st blank  - rate satisfaction now. 2nd blank your desired level of satisfaction.

3rd blank  difference between the two.  E.g.  6 / 9/   3 is the differential.

Rate each of the following areas of your Health and Wellbeing

PHYSICAL- includes the quality / healthiness of your diet, how often you exercise or engage in physical movement, your energy levels, immunity, how well you recover from illness and overall feeling of vitality and health.   _____________/ ____________. _____________

EMOTIONAL / MENTAL – includes how well you cope with day -to -day stressors, how positive your attitude is, how well you are attuned with yourself and aware of your emotions, how well you manage big feelings (sadness, anger, frustration), how you manage any anxiety, depression or grief, how you manage yourself through problems and trials, and how resilient you would describe yourself.  __________/____________                            _____________

SPIRITUAL – includes how attuned you are to what you believe, how you practice your faith, what faith or religious habits you do and how your faith or religion guides your values, choices and direction.  _____________/___________   ___________

RELATIONAL-  How  the quality is of your primary relationships.  Does your primary relationship, partner/ spouse, feel safe, joy filled and satisfying?  How do you feel about your relationships with children, extended family overall? _________/_________   __________

SOCIAL/ FRIENDSHIPS/ COMMUNITY- How much time do you make to nurture meaningful friendships?  To what degree do you feel you have social support?  How much do you integrate yourself into the community? Volunteer?  How often do you make time to be social with others, either individually or as a couple?  __________/_________    __________

FINANCIAL – How financially secure are you feeling?  Do you have a plan for saving/ investing/spending/giving?  Do you feel content or stressed more often about money? Is money and/ or financial issues a huge factor in arguments, distress or are you managing both money, and emotions around money, well?  __________/__________.  ___________

WORK LIFE AND WORK LIFE BALANCE-Are you content with where your business is at?  Is the health or sustainability or profitability keeping you up at night?  Are you able to find balance, to offload and/or delegate and /or hire out tasks that someone else can do?  Does your job or business cause strife between you and a partner?  Are you feeling supported as a business owner or at your job?   ___________/ ___________   ___________

SELF CARE- SELF MANAGEMENT- How often do you take time for you? Time to enjoy solitude, to rest or rejuvenate?  How often do you say no when saying yes will put you over the edge in stress, or be a detriment to your health?  ________/________     ___________

The answers and the differentials to these questions, along with reconnecting with our values can be used in myriad ways to further our health and wellbeing in a holistic way.   

How this applies to ENERGY AND TIME MANAGEMENT:


Learning how to manage energy is as important as everything else you have identified.  If our energy is low in the afternoon, but we are scheduling important priority tasks and meetings at that time without doing anything to change our energy level, we are setting ourselves up for a difficult challenge.


Learning how energy and emotional management is essential to having agency over our life, health, work, relationships and schedule can make an amazing difference in our lives.

When we learn to understand ourselves more accurately and manage ourselves more effectively, we can get more done in less time with increased efficiency and decreased stress.


We encourage you to begin to make a Master 40 day Strategic Schedule taking into account what you have discovered- your values, priorities, energy and more.  Consider your commitments and schedule them first and then ensure you have actionable items identified for each category under your value statements.


Now you can begin to make your schedule.
